#linux #amazon-web-services #snapshot
#linux #amazon-веб-сервисы #снимок
Вопрос:
Я хочу получить все снимки определенного тома.
Допустим, есть том, идентификатор vol-23fei9
тома которого равен, и есть 6 разных снимков этого тома. Я хочу извлечь идентификатор снимка всех 6 снимков, сделанных с тома vol-23fei9
.
Есть ли какой-либо способ извлечь информацию?
Ответ №1:
Вы можете использовать команду / API командной строки describe-snapshots . Добавьте --filter
то, что является volume-id
. Это вернет все снимки для данного тома.
Ответ №2:
Хитрость заключается в том, чтобы понять, что снимки связаны с томами (а не наоборот).
Эта команда отобразит все снимки, связанные с томом:
aws ec2 describe-snapshots --filter "Name=volume-id,Values=vol-23fei9"
Чтобы ограничить вывод простым отображением идентификатора снимков:
aws ec2 describe-snapshots --filter "Name=volume-id,Values=vol-23fei9" --query 'Snapshots[*].SnapshotId' --output text
snap-e0ded613
См. Документацию по интерфейсу командной строки AWS (CLI) для описания моментальных снимков